My Buying Guides on Vocal Spray For Singers
When I look for a vocal spray for singers, I focus on comfort, safety, and how well it supports my voice during long rehearsals or performances. A good spray should help keep my throat feeling hydrated without causing irritation or leaving a strange taste behind.
1. What I Look for in a Vocal Spray
I always check the ingredients first. I prefer sprays with soothing and moisturizing ingredients like aloe vera, glycerin, or herbal extracts. I avoid products with harsh alcohol content, strong artificial flavors, or anything that makes my throat feel dry afterward.
2. Hydration Support
For me, the main purpose of a vocal spray is hydration. I want something that helps my throat feel refreshed, especially before singing or after long periods of talking. If a spray claims to support vocal comfort, I make sure it actually feels gentle and effective when I use it.
3. Ease of Use
I like a spray that is easy to carry and simple to apply. Since I may need it during rehearsals, on stage, or while traveling, I prefer a compact bottle with a reliable spray nozzle. If it’s messy or difficult to use quickly, I usually skip it.
4. Taste and Sensation
I pay attention to the taste because anything too strong can distract me while singing. I usually choose mild, pleasant flavors or unscented options. I also want the spray to feel soothing, not burning or overly sticky.
5. Safety and Ingredients
I always read the label carefully. Since I use vocal spray close to performance time, I want to be sure it is safe for regular use. I avoid products with ingredients that might trigger allergies or throat sensitivity. When in doubt, I check with a vocal coach or healthcare professional.
6. Performance Needs
My choice depends on how I use my voice. If I am performing often, I want a spray that helps me stay comfortable through long sets. If I am only using it occasionally, I may choose a simpler option. I look for one that fits my singing routine rather than just picking the most popular brand.
7. Value for Money
I compare price with quality. A higher price does not always mean better results, so I look at the ingredient list, bottle size, and how long it lasts. I prefer a spray that gives me good value without sacrificing comfort.
